Bluegrass Community and Technical College Overview

Bluegrass Community and Technical College is a two-year, mixed part/full-time, higher education institution located in Lexington, KY. It has an enrollment of 7,612 undergraduate students. The admissions acceptance rate is unreported.

The average annual cost of attendance after financial aid is $6,145. Tuition is $4,568.00 without financial aid.

Bluegrass Community and Technical College is a predominantly certificate-degree granting school.

At Bluegrass Community and Technical College, of students return after freshman year (national average: 68%).

Bluegrass Community and Technical College has a student-to-faculty ratio of 18 to 1.

Bluegrass Community and Technical College Cost

The average annual cost of attendance after financial aid is $6,145. The in-state tuition is $4,568.00. Out-of-state tuition is $15,320.00

The average tuition is:

  • $4,492, when family income is less than $30,000
  • $5,288, when family income is between $30,001 and $48,000 
  • $7,537, when family income is between $48,001 and $75,000
  • $10,333, when family income is between $75,001 and $110,000
  • $10,845, when family income is more than $110,000 

The average tuition shown here is based on the NET costs to students who receive financial aid. For the incoming class of 2023, 25.01% of students received a federal student loan and 38.73% of students received a Pell Grant.

Tuition is $15,320.00 without financial aid, or the in-state tuition discount.

Recent Graduate Salaries

(Average salaries of students from select majors two years after graduation)

  • Computer and Information Sciences, General. (Associate’s Degree) – $37,568
  • Cosmetology and Related Personal Grooming Services. (Undergraduate Certificate or Diploma) – $18,087
  • Drafting/Design Engineering Technologies/Technicians. (Associate’s Degree) – $29,685
  • Liberal Arts and Sciences, General Studies and Humanities. (Associate’s Degree) – $25,865
  • Multi/Interdisciplinary Studies, Other. (Associate’s Degree) – $50,231
  • Criminal Justice and Corrections. (Associate’s Degree) – $37,593
  • Heating, Air Conditioning, Ventilation and Refrigeration Maintenance Technology/Technician (HAC, HACR, HVAC, HVACR). (Associate’s Degree) – $42,123
  • Heavy/Industrial Equipment Maintenance Technologies. (Associate’s Degree) – $66,244
  • Vehicle Maintenance and Repair Technologies. (Associate’s Degree) – $30,554
  • Precision Metal Working. (Associate’s Degree) – $26,933
  • Dental Support Services and Allied Professions. (Associate’s Degree) – $43,519
  • Health and Medical Administrative Services. (Associate’s Degree) – $25,774
  • Allied Health Diagnostic, Intervention, and Treatment Professions. (Associate’s Degree) – $43,493
  • Registered Nursing, Nursing Administration, Nursing Research and Clinical Nursing. (Associate’s Degree) – $51,317
  • Practical Nursing, Vocational Nursing and Nursing Assistants. (Undergraduate Certificate or Diploma) – $37,928
  • Business Administration, Management and Operations. (Associate’s Degree) – $28,598
  • Business Operations Support and Assistant Services. (Associate’s Degree) – $26,121

Bluegrass Community and Technical College Diversity

The racial diversity of students who received financial aid at Bluegrass Community and Technical College

  • American Indian/Alaska Native: 0.16%
  • Asian: 2.15%
  • Black: 13.74%
  • Hispanic: 8.87%
  • Native Hawaiian/Pacific Islander: 0.18%
  • Non-resident alien: 0.14%
  • Two or more races: 4.34%
  • Unknown: 1.00%
  • White: 69.42%

At Bluegrass Community and Technical College, 32.98% of undergraduate students are 25 years old, or older.
